headbump (plural headbumps)

  1. A light nudge or bump done with the head as an affectionate gesture, typically by an animal.
  2. A naturally-occurring bump on the cranium, especially as analyzed in phrenology.

headbump (third-person singular simple present headbumps, present participle headbumping, simple past and past participle headbumped)

  1. (especially of an animal) To nudge or bump with the head as a gesture.
